WebThe rules in §§ 1910.34 through 1910.39 cover the minimum requirements for exit routes that employers must provide in their workplace so that employees may evacuate the workplace safely during an emergency. Sections 1910.34 through 1910.39 also cover the minimum requirements for emergency action plans and fire prevention plans. 1910.34 (c) WebDec 19, 2006 · Hotel Fire Safety – the current regulations. A major component is egress and that has many parts. the … WebSep 8, 2024 · The size of the stage will determine what types of additional fire protection will be required. Any stage over 1,000 sq. ft. or where the height from the stage floor to the ceiling is greater than 50 feet will require a ventilation and smoke control system.
